Understanding Registered Agent Services

A designated agent is an individual or entity designated for receiving legal documents and government correspondence on behalf of a business entity. This role is essential for ensuring compliance with state regulations and guaranteeing that a business stays in good standing. The designated agent acts as a intermediary between the company and regulatory bodies, receiving service of process notifications, tax documents, and other important communications.

Choosing a trustworthy registered agent is important for entrepreneurs, as neglecting to respond to legal notifications can lead to grave consequences, including penalties or adverse rulings. Registered agents are typically required to have a physical presence in the state in which the business is incorporated. This can be an person residing in the state or a registered agent company that provides these solutions for multiple clients. Expenses and Charges Associated with Registered Agents

While selecting a registered agent, understanding the costs entailed is vital for successful business strategies. Usually, the charges applied for registration services can differ based on the company, the complexity of services provided, and your particular location. Some agent firms may charge as few as fifty dollars a year, while some providers, especially those offering extra compliance services, can exceed beyond three hundred dollars annually. Always take into account the services included in the cost, as some lower-cost options may not provide comprehensive assistance.

Besides the regular yearly costs, there may be further costs to take into account, such as charges for registered agent renewal, compliance notifications, or annual report filings. Organizations might also face charges for specific services like handling documents or providing a virtual address. It is essential to review the small print in your registered agent agreement to avoid hidden fees that could increase your overall expenditure, notably if your business needs change as time goes on.

Altering The Registered Agent

Changing the registered agent is a simple process, but it demands careful attention to local regulations and compliance requirements. The first step is to select a different registered agent provider that aligns with your business needs, whether you are looking for cost-effectiveness, reliability, or exact services such as web-based management or annual compliance assistance. Once you have picked a fresh registered agent, it is crucial to review your existing registered agent agreement to understand any obligations or notice periods that may apply.

After choosing a different registered agent, you will need to complete the correct change registered agent form provided by your state’s business filing office. This form generally requires essential information about your business, including your entity name and registration number, as well as the fresh agent's contact details. Ensure that you file the completed form along with any required fees, as specified by your state’s registered agent regulations.

Once your application to alter the registered agent is handled, confirm that the new registered agent is officially recognized in the state’s records. It is also a good practice to alert your previous registered agent of the change. Advantages of Using a Professional Designated Agent

One of the main benefits of engaging a qualified registered agent is the guarantee of adherence with local regulations. Every business organization is obligated to have a registered agent to accept crucial legal documents and notifications. By utilizing a reliable registered agent service, businesses can ensure that they do not overlook important deadlines or neglect to respond to legal notices, which can lead to significant penalties or even closure of the company.

Additionally, another important benefit is the increase of privacy. Using a professional registered agent allows entrepreneurs to maintain their private addresses off the public registry, providing an extra layer of confidentiality. This is particularly important for entrepreneurs running small businesses or individuals who operate from home, as it assists maintain personal privacy while fulfilling legal requirements.
